This review is about the main restaurant (we didn't stay at the hotel).
Wife and I were excited to dine there as the menu looked great although the mid-week menu is somewhat small compared to whats on offer over the weekend.
We ordered the Baked mushroom and Zuchini flowers for entree, The Eye Fillet Steak and Ocean Perch Fillet as main and Creme Brulet as dessert. Service was friendly and prompt, so no complaints there. Location was ok with a somewhat limited view to a small part of the beach. Unfortunately thats where the positive aspects end. I am not sure where the money from the steep prices of the meals go, but its certainly not reflected in the food. I would argue that most average pubs these days serve better meals than that. The single mushroom in that tomato sauce was half cold and really bland, not much taste at all. Not sure what those poor little cauliflower elements did on the plate, made no sense. And $28 for that? The Zucchini flowers were pretty good and tasty, however I would again say for those poor little flowers to charge $24 is astronomical. Then the steak came, which was reasonably good but again - not worth $48. Presented like a cheap pub meal with some chips on the side - the price doesn't match what you get.
The low-light was my wife's Ocean Perch. It looked and tasted like something out of a deep frozen McCain pack - $32 for that is a disgrace. Even if it was free, that dish should not be served that way in any restaurant.
Overall - I felt the presentation, quality and overall taste of the food is an embarrassment for the resort. It does not match what the hotel is trying to be. Lovely staff as I said, but the food there is a big let down and rip-off, you better off eating elsewhere.
